Annual Chariot Festival of the Sri Karpaga Vinayagar Hindu Temple in Walthamstow.
The Annual Chariot Festival of the Sri Karpaga Vinayagar Hindu Temple took place in Walthamstow in East London over the Bank holiday weekend
Men with hooks through their skin were suspended from cranes on floats as the chariot was pulled round the area by worshippers to bless it and to mark the end of 13 days of celebrations.
